Ivonne and Thomas Gross win Salzburg Summer Tournament to qualify for Bowling World Cup

    09/02/07

    Austria

    Star Bowling in Salzburg, Austria (August 25-26, 2007)

    Last year, Ivonne and Thomas Gross, became the first couple to qualify for the World Ranking Masters. This year, the Austrians qualified to represent Austria in the 43rd QubicaAMF Bowling World Cup in St. Petersburg, Russia.

    Ivonne and Thomas won the women's and men's division at Salzburg Summer Tournament & BWC Qualifier to earn the coveted tickets to the BWC to be held from November 3 through 11, 2007.

     The tournament was contested at Star Bowling in Salzburg, Austria, a state-of-the-art bowling center, which opened its doors earlier this year. The old Star Bowling center was closed after the roof collapsed under heavy snow in the winter of 2006.

    The top 16 men from All Events (five games Singles plus five games Doubles) and all of the mere seven (!!) female participants qualified for finals to bowl for BWC tickets. The player with the highest pinfall total after nine games was declared the winner.

    2007BWCIvonneGross.jpg Ivonne (left) started out commandingly by rolling games of 224, 257, 225 and 223 and never looked back. She finished with 1828 pinfall total, an average of 203.11, to secure her fifth berth into the Bowling World Cup. Gabi Loos (1795) and Evelyn Tutschka (1785) came up strong but had to settle for second and third place, respectively.

    2007BWCThomasGross.jpg Phillip Bauer led the men's field after five of nine games by 49 pins, but Thomas (right) closed out his series with 247, 279, 276 and 225 (1027) to seal the victory with 2107 pinfall total and an average of 234.11.

    This will be the first World Cup participation in his career for Thomas Gross. Bauer finished second at 2065 with Adalbert Einböck in third at 1990.
